Is there any way to surf on a Kindle without setting up an Amazon account and making up a password. . .???
I haven't actually tried going without an Amazon account, but the Kindle manual implies that setting up an Amazon account and registering a device is optional, and only necessary if one wants to buy and download ebooks directly from Amazon.
By "surf on a Kindle" I assume you mean using the Kindle's built-in "Experimental" web browser to access the internet directly and download books directly from internet sites such as Gutenberg.org, which should be possible without an Amazon account.
Maybe someone getting a new Kindle can actually try and confirm that it is possible to use the web browser prior to registering a device? [I'd hate to have to deregister a Kindle which I have already registered just to check this out]
I confirmed it's *not* possible. Trying to use the experimental browser, even to go to amazon.com, lands back on the registration page. It doesn't even seem to start. -- Greg
